Output 31654e508bf7e5ae5fb5674c590e57e7739eeb21725c19bae029362bdcbd4900:1

value
990556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e2d0bfab3fc0fddba0f5503fc4ad030e15222c OP_EQUAL
address
MLHfAjqBwhRWnjMP8uPURzk7zm9pz6CueB
transaction
31654e508bf7e5ae5fb5674c590e57e7739eeb21725c19bae029362bdcbd4900
spent
true